Celebrate your big day in unforgettable style with The Perfect Match Wedding Collection from Hither Green Florist. Thoughtfully designed for modern couples, this premium wedding flower package brings together romantic blooms, elegant shapes and luxurious fragrance for a truly show-stopping look.

Choose from three flexible packages tailored to your guest list. The Intimate Package (50-75 guests) includes 1 bridal bouquet, 3 bridesmaid bouquets and 4 groom boutonnieres - perfect for smaller, personal celebrations. The Original Package (75-100 guests) adds extra bridesmaid and groom flowers for a fuller bridal party. For large weddings of 100+ guests, the Ultimate Package delivers maximum impact with 1 bridal bouquet, 7 bridesmaid bouquets and 8 groom boutonnieres.
